The Challenge
Design software exports often contained incorrect 'type test references'-model numbers instead of proper ENA codes. These invalid references caused DNO applications to be rejected or delayed, requiring manual rework to look up and correct the references. The problem: garbage data from upstream systems was flowing unchecked into compliance paperwork.

The Solution
Built product catalog with authoritative type-test references sourced from ENA 'Live Devices' database. Validation logic in application pack generation checks equipment references against the catalog, preventing garbage data from reaching DNO applications. The system ensures that only accurate, ENA-validated references appear in compliance paperwork.

Implementation Approach
Product catalog was populated with correct type-test references from the ENA 'Live Devices' database. Application generation logic validates equipment references against this catalog before creating G98/G99 packs. When design software data contains garbage references, the system flags the issue and uses the authoritative catalog value instead.
